For manipulating curves and measured laminations on surfaces and producing mapping tori.

Project description


Flipper is a program for computing the action of mapping classes on
laminations on punctured surfaces using ideal triangulation coordinates.

It can decide the Nielsen--Thurston type of a given mapping class and,
for pseudo-Anosov mapping classes, construct a layered, veering
triangulation of their mapping torus, as described by Agol.

Flipper can be run as a Python 2, Python 3 or Sage Python module. Currently
it is fastest as a Sage Python module.


Flipper is available on the Python Package Index (PyPI). The preferred method
for installing the latest stable release is to use pip:
> python -m pip install flipper-triangulation --user --upgrade
Pip can be installed using get-pip.py from
http://pip.readthedocs.org/en/latest/installing.html
and is included in Python 3.4 by default.

Flipper can also be installed through the older easy_install:
> python -m easy_install flipper-triangulation


For more information about installing and using flipper see "A users
guide to flipper". Open by running:
> python -m flipper.doc
